Michael Holt makes winning return at Championship League snooker after replacing Ronnie O'Sullivan

Michael Holt took full advantage of Ronnie O'Sullivan's decision to skip the Championship League by winning Group 1 in Leicester after replacing the seven-time world champion at the season's first ranking event. Holt failed to regain his tour card at Q School last month after losing his place on the main circuit a year ago, but showed he still has the class to mix it with the elite by defeating Alfie Burden 3-0 in their group decider to progress on frames won.

Ng On Yee reveals plans to regain spot on World Snooker Tour after women's British Open setback

Three-time women's world champion Ng On Yee is set to head for Q School in Thailand next month in a bid to earn a new two-year World Snooker Tour card. The talented Hong Kong player suffered a 3-2 defeat to teenager Bai Yulu of China in the quarter-finals of the women's British Open last week to dash her hopes of remaining on the professional circuit after finishing outside the top 64 cut-off mark in the rankings. World Snooker Championship 2023 qualifying: Jimmy White faces potential Marco Fu clash, Stephen Henry v James Cahill

Jimmy White faces a potential showdown against Marco Fu in the second qualifying round of the World Snooker Championship. The draw for the four qualifying rounds, which take place from April 3 to April 12 at the English Institute of Sport in Sheffield, will see the field of 128 players whittled down to the final 32 for the Crucible showpiece event.
